
June has been an eventful month at the Uniswap Foundation, marked by significant progress across our grant programs and intensive planning for UniDay in Brussels. In our commitment to transparency and community engagement, we’re thrilled to share the key developments from our team in June 2024.
Demo Day: On June 19, Atrium Academy hosted a Hookathon, showcasing innovative hook projects from the first cohort of the Uniswap Hook Incubator. Here is an exciting recap.
Applications for Round 2: Applications for the second cohort of the Uniswap Hook Incubator opened and closed on June 28.
Applications for cohort #3 are now open, with the kickoff scheduled for October.
Research
New Grant Announcement: We are proud to announce the launch of the Uniswap Community Research Program.
TLDR Fellowship Applications Closed: Applications for the TLDR Fellowship have officially closed, and the next cohort of fellows have been chosen! Stay tuned for more details on the exceptional researchers.
DEX Analytics Portal by Allium: We are pleased to share the link to the current MVP of the Allium DEX Analytics Portal.
Research Summer Series: Ken Ng, UF’s Head of Research, led an invite-only Research Summer Series at Edge City Esmeralda in Healdsburg, California.
Governance
Governance HackHouse: At Edge City City Esmeralda in June, we held a two-day working session with talks by experts in the field of governance, AI agents, and futarchy. The objective was to increase Uniswap Protocol Governance participation.
